Chiefs star addresses clip of him seemingly complaining about tush push

Kansas City Chiefs star Chris Jones claimed a viral clip of him complaining about the Philadelphia Eagles’ plays was not a reaction to the tush push.

The NFL released in-game audio from the Eagles’ 20-17 win over the Chiefs on Sunday in which Jones could be heard complaining on the bench after Philadelphia scored a touchdown on the tush push play. Naturally, it was widely assumed that Jones was complaining about that specific play given he complained that the Eagles “ran the same play seven f—ing times.”

According to Jones, that was not the case. He said Thursday the Eagles kept running inside zone runs against the Chiefs to great success.

“I never once complained about the tush push on the sideline,” Jones said. “We actually stopped the tush push multiple times. The clip y’all seen is portrayed as, they ran the tush push, that came out. No, that was because they ran the inside zone five times, and I’m like, as a defensive line, we’ve got to adjust to that.”

There is no questioning that Jones was very frustrated at the end of the Chiefs’ loss. His attempt at trash-talking Eagles quarterback Jalen Hurts was thrown back in his face pretty brutally.

The Chiefs are 0-2, a position players like Jones are not accustomed to being in. He has been an All-Pro for three consecutive seasons, but like many of his teammates, things have been tough to start 2025.

Jones’ frustration may not have been directed at the tush push in this specific instance, but there are definitely some people that would apply the same sentiment to it.
